Fully furnished yr round home near Seneca Lake, on Wine trail, Family Friendly
"A Stone's Throw"
4 bedroom 1.5 bath 2200 sq ft home centrally located between Geneva and Watkins Glen on the west side of Seneca Lake. Residing in a quaint small town. Walking distance to the lake, local bar/restaurant and the kueka outlet hiking/biking trail that has 2 beautiful waterfalls. Just minutes from the regions premier wineries and breweries and only 10 minutes to Penn Yan. Fully furnished interior comfortably sleeps 10 with 1 king bed, 2 queen beds and 2 twin trundle beds. Includes year round sun porch - great for those rainy days. Exterior has a large backyard with a firepit. Plenty of seating inside and out. On-site laundry, with all linens and towels provided.

Where is Fully furnished yr round home near Seneca Lake, on Wine trail, Family Friendly located?
Situated in Dresden, this holiday home is 0.3 mi (0.4 km) from Seneca Lake and within 6 miles (10 km) of Prejean Winery and Torrey Ridge Winery. Keuka Lake Outlet Trail and Fox Run Vineyards are also within 6 miles (10 km).
